When furnace turns off blower will continue to run?

The blower on a furnace is designed to circulate the heated air throughout the room or house. It is typically controlled by the thermostat and will turn on when the furnace begins to heat the air and turn off when the desired temperature is reached. Most furnaces also have a setting for the blower to continue to run after the furnace has turned off, this is called the "continuous fan" or "fan only" setting.

The continuous fan setting can be useful for circulating air in the house and helping to maintain a consistent temperature throughout. It can also help to improve air quality by circulating air through the filter. However, it is important to note that the continuous fan setting can also increase energy usage.
